Ellipse With Units
==================

Compare the ellipse generated with arcs versus a polygonal approximation

.. only:: builder_html

   This example requires :download:`basic_units.py <basic_units.py>`



.. code-block:: python

    from basic_units import cm
    import numpy as np
    from matplotlib import patches
    import matplotlib.pyplot as plt


    xcenter, ycenter = 0.38*cm, 0.52*cm
    width, height = 1e-1*cm, 3e-1*cm
    angle = -30

    theta = np.deg2rad(np.arange(0.0, 360.0, 1.0))
    x = 0.5 * width * np.cos(theta)
    y = 0.5 * height * np.sin(theta)

    rtheta = np.radians(angle)
    R = np.array([
        [np.cos(rtheta), -np.sin(rtheta)],
        [np.sin(rtheta),  np.cos(rtheta)],
        ])


    x, y = np.dot(R, np.array([x, y]))
    x += xcenter
    y += ycenter








.. code-block:: python


    fig = plt.figure()
    ax = fig.add_subplot(211, aspect='auto')
    ax.fill(x, y, alpha=0.2, facecolor='yellow',
            edgecolor='yellow', linewidth=1, zorder=1)

    e1 = patches.Ellipse((xcenter, ycenter), width, height,
                         angle=angle, linewidth=2, fill=False, zorder=2)

    ax.add_patch(e1)

    ax = fig.add_subplot(212, aspect='equal')
    ax.fill(x, y, alpha=0.2, facecolor='green', edgecolor='green', zorder=1)
    e2 = patches.Ellipse((xcenter, ycenter), width, height,
                         angle=angle, linewidth=2, fill=False, zorder=2)


    ax.add_patch(e2)
    fig.savefig('ellipse_compare')
